Understanding Advantage Players
Advantage players are individuals who use knowledge, strategy, or observation to tilt the odds in their favor without directly cheating. Examples include card counters in blackjack, skilled poker players who exploit betting patterns, or individuals who track mechanical or electronic vulnerabilities in gaming devices. While these players often operate within legal boundaries, their consistent ability to win can result in significant financial losses for casinos. Eat-and-Run Police play a crucial role in identifying these patterns early, preventing long-term exploitation.
Observation and Behavioral Analysis
A cornerstone of detecting advantage players is careful observation. Eat-and-Run Police are trained to monitor subtle behaviors that may indicate strategic play. These include variations in betting patterns, timing of bets, and reactions to game outcomes. Advantage players often employ disciplined approaches that differ from casual gamblers. By analyzing these behaviors, Eat-and-Run Police can distinguish between skilled play and potential fraud.
In addition to observing individual actions, officers look for patterns over time. Frequent visits to specific tables, repeated success in particular games, or coordination among multiple players can signal advantage play. Continuous tracking and detailed record-keeping allow casinos to respond proactively before significant losses occur.
Technological Assistance
Technology enhances the ability of Eat-and-Run Police to identify advantage players. Surveillance systems with high-definition cameras and facial recognition can track individuals across the casino floor. Advanced analytics can flag unusual winning streaks or betting patterns, prompting closer investigation. Player databases store historical activity, allowing for comparison and trend analysis. These tools make it easier to separate skillful play from chance or potential cheating.

Preventive Measures
While advantage play may not always violate legal regulations, casinos take preventive measures to limit its impact. These measures include rotating dealers, varying game conditions, and using automatic shuffling machines to reduce predictability. Eat-and-Run Police advise management on table limits, game rules, and other adjustments that can mitigate consistent advantage play. By implementing proactive strategies, casinos maintain fairness while discouraging exploitation.
